VECT: Clear LOOP_VINFO_USING_SELECT_VL_P when loop is not partial vectorized
This patch fixes ICE:

The root cause is we generate such IR in vectorization:
The IR _18 = vect_vec_iv_.6_14 + vect_cst__11; is generated because of we are adding induction variable with
the result of SELECT_VL instead of VF.
The code is:
else if (LOOP_VINFO_USING_SELECT_VL_P (loop_vinfo))
{
/* When we're using loop_len produced by SELEC_VL, the non-final
iterations are not always processing VF elements. So vectorize
induction variable instead of
LOOP_VINFO_USING_SELECT_VL_P is set before loop vectorization analysis so we don't know whether it is partial
vectorization or not but the induction variable depends on SELECT_VL_P is true.
So update SELECT_VL_P as false when it is not partial vectorization.
PR middle-end/112554
gcc/ChangeLog:
* tree-vect-loop.cc (vect_determine_partial_vectors_and_peeling):
Clear SELECT_VL_P for non-partial vectorization.
